Transaction 010473fc113cfd66174003c86c6a03d1b508f5a60fa87023e76daad2f47f21ea
1 Input
1 Output
-
010473fc113cfd66174003c86c6a03d1b508f5a60fa87023e76daad2f47f21ea:0
- value
- 1126060
- script pubkey
- OP_0 OP_PUSHBYTES_20 5f4875036dba5efd3935367fb5aaec6a1f986c55
- address
- bc1qtay82qmdhf006wf4xelmt2hvdg0esmz44vtl2a